Isy 115 Explora Yacht | 125' Inace 2027

Key Features

  • New-construction ISY 115 Explora, currently in preliminary design/engineering phase (RINA class, Marshall Islands flag)
  • Full-beam Owner's suite on the upper deck with an integrated en-suite steam shower
  • Twin diesel main engines (CAT C32B or MAN V12X, IMO Tier III) delivering an approx. 4,000nm range at 10 knots
  • Family Room fitted with a dry sauna, built to marine thermal insulation, ventilation and safety standards
  • 1,500kg-capacity foredeck tender crane, man-riding certified, sized for a Williams 565 / Castoldi 568 tender
  • Hydraulic Z-lift swim platform (650kg SWL) plus a removable aluminum side boarding ladder to port and starboard
  • Two independent reverse-osmosis desalination plants (min. 200 l/hr each)

Specifications
  • Cruising Speed: 10 kn
  • Maximum Speed: 15 kn
  • Beam: 24' 11''
  • Hull Material: Steel
  • Max Draft: 8' 2''
  • Fuel Tank: 1 x 50000|liter
  • Fresh Water: 2 x 10000|liter
  • Holding: 1 x 4000|liter
  • Max Passengers: 12
  • Cabins: 8
  • Heads: 11
Classification, Certification & Markings

The items below are drawn from the INACE standard scope and certification responsibilities; items noted as subject to Owner's Representative approval or Owner selection remain open choices for the Owner to make during the build.

Classification & Certification
Specifications throughout this document are drawn up to Marshall Islands flag-state requirements.

  • Classification Society: RINA
  • Class Notation: C✠ HULL • MACH Ych, Unrestricted Navigation (pending final selection;
  • Additional Class Notation AUT CCS(Y) to be considered as optional, at Owner's choice)
  • Service: Pleasure Yacht, unrestricted navigation
  • Navigation: GMDSS Navigation Area A3; Flag State Marshall Islands
  • Certification: INACE is responsible for arranging and obtaining, at Builder's cost, all certificates and documentation required for international voyages and unrestricted operation in IMO member states at the time of delivery

Names & Markings

  • Vessel Name: INACE will apply the Owner-selected vessel name in three locations — the jacuzzi surround and both port/starboard house sides — with letters in polished AISI 316 stainless steel; final signage design and placement subject to Owner's Representative approval
  • Ship's Name & Port of Registration (Transom): name and home port of registration are to be arranged on the transom per Owner's selection, subject to Owner's Representative approval
  • Ship's Registration & Official Number: displayed on the Yacht per the statutory requirements of the Flag State
  • Ship's Carving Plate: arranged as required by the Statutory Authorities
  • Nameplates — General, Accommodation, Technical Areas & Equipment: engraved in English and mechanically fastened, to INACE's standard plate design, used throughout the Yacht's accommodation, technical spaces and equipment for inventory identification; subject to Owner's Representative approval
Machinery

Main Engines

  • (2) CATERPILLAR C32B or MAN V12X (alternate) marine diesel engines
    • 12-cylinder, IMO Tier III, turbocharged, aftercooled, electronically controlled fuel injection — approx. 1,000 bhp each @ 1,800–2,100 rpm
  • Engine controls: electronic remote control with synchronizer at wheelhouse and both wing stations, plus a fixed stern control station; optional Sun Deck helm station with 16" Garmin (or equivalent) multifunction display

Propulsion & Steering

  • Shafts: stainless steel, Villares (or equal), water-lubricated with split-ring seals
  • Propellers: (2) 5-blade fixed pitch, Ni-Al-bronze, Teignbridge (or equal)
  • Gear boxes: ZF2300 (or Twin Disc, alternate), oil-cooled with pressure/temperature alarms
  • Steering system: twin balanced, profiled rudders (±35°), Kobelt (or Wills Ridley, alternate)

Stabilizers & Thrusters

  • Stabilizers: Zero-speed fin type, CMC (or Humphree / Sleipner, alternate)
  • Bow & stern thrusters: hydraulic or electric, approx. 1,000kg S2 rating, CMC (or Side Power / Italwinch, alternate)
Generators & Auxiliary Systems

Generators

  • (2) main diesel generator sets, approx. 99 ekW each, make Kohler (or CAT, alternate)
  • A third generator, dedicated to hotel/night-mode load, to be specified during detailed engineering
  • Generator start system: electric, with redundant back-up and cross-over between main engines

Shore Power & Electrical

  • Shore power: (1) three-phase connection with frequency converter, make Atlas (or A-Sea, alternate)
    • 208–480V, 50/60Hz; approx. 30m cable set stored in the Lazarette; optional Glendinning retractable reel
    • Connection location: aft peak
    • Output specification: 400V, 3-phase, 50Hz to the main switchboard
  • Main power system: custom main switchboard (Tek-sea or Atlas, alternate) with one generator section per genset plus a dedicated shore field
  • Batteries: separate Service, Emergency, GMDSS, and Start battery banks, monitored via the alarm/monitoring system
  • Battery chargers: Tek-sea (or Mastervolt, alternate)
Tank Capacities

  • Fuel Capacity: 50,000L (13,209 US gal)
  • Fresh Water Capacity: 10,000 L (2,642 US gal)
  • Holding Tanks
    • Black & Grey Water Capacity: 2,000 L (528 US gal)
    • Total Sewage Capacity: 4,000 L (105 US gal)
  • Lube Oil Tank
    • New Oil: 500 L (132 US gal)
    • Waste Oil: 500L (132 US gal)
  • Bilge Water Capacity: 470 L (124 US gal)
Ancillary Equipment

Climate Control

  • Air conditioning: (2) sea-water-cooled chilled-water HVAC plants, make Flow Marine (or Dometic, alternate), modular with a minimum of 2 compressors per chiller for redundancy, and individual fancoil temperature control in every accommodation space
  • Make-up air: central air-handling units with filtration, chilling and dehumidification
  • Air compressors: Schulz CSD 18/100 (or Bauer, alternate)

Fresh Water Systems

  • Fresh water purification: (2) independent reverse-osmosis desalination plants, min. 200 l/hr each, make Ecomac / FCI (or SPOT ZERO, alternate)
  • Fresh water pumps: (2) pressure pump sets, min. 4 bar working pressure (1 duty, 1 standby)
  • Water heaters: (2) hot water storage tanks, approx. 200 L each, make Thermolar (or equal)

Fuel & Lubrication Systems

  • Fuel oil separator: CJC (or Alfa Laval, alternate)
  • Fuel filters: Racor

Bilge & Sewage Systems

  • Main bilge pump: electrically driven, self-priming, installed in the engine room
  • Emergency bilge/fire pump: diesel-driven, self-priming, independent of the main bilge system, connected to the auxiliary raw water inlet
  • Sewage treatment system: Mini Biocon / Biocon (or equal, alternate)
Safety Equipment

All safety equipment is designed and installed in accordance with applicable Classification Society and Marshall Islands flag state requirements.

Fire-Fighting Equipment

  • Fire control system: automatic smoke and fire detection in every compartment, with heat detectors in the engine room and galley; addressable mimic panel in the wheelhouse, make Conselium (or Fireboy, alternate)
  • Sea water fire main: electrically driven self-priming centrifugal pump, cross-connected to the bilge system as back-up
  • Engine room fire suppression: FM200 (or equal, alternate); CO2 system for the galley hood
  • Fire extinguishers, fire blankets, fire suits: per Classification Society and Flag State requirements
  • Smoke detectors: fitted throughout, per Class requirements
  • Fire alarm bells: general alarm via loudspeaker network, plus a manual station near the tender fuel filling point

Life-Saving Equipment

  • Life rafts: offshore-approved type sized for full complement, stored on extendable cradles at the sundeck, manually deployed, with hydrostatic release
  • Personal flotation devices: lifejackets for full complement, per Statutory Authority requirements
  • Immersion suits: per Statutory Authority requirements
  • Life rings: recessed lifebuoy racks, quantity per Statutory Authority requirements
  • Rescue tender: Owner-supplied inflatable, max. loaded weight 1,500kg (incl. engines), foredeck stowage (SWL increase optional)
  • EPIRBs / SARTs / Flares: certified and supplied per Class and Statutory Authority requirements

Medical Equipment

  • Medical kit: Owner-supplied, per Statutory Authority requirements
Communication Equipment

  • GMDSS: fully classified, Navigation Area A3
  • Internal ship's communication: general alarm and loudspeaker announcement system fitted throughout
Deck Equipment & Arrangement

  • Anchors: (2) fully balanced, hidden, galvanized-steel High-Holding-Power bow anchors with stainless-steel chafe protection
  • Anchor chain: (2) galvanized-steel chains, 7 shackles each, per Class requirements
  • Anchor windlass: (2) hydraulic stainless-steel windlasses on the foredeck, with roller stoppers/tensioners and chain counters
  • Mooring capstans: (2) electric vertical stainless-steel warping capstans (AISI 316) on the aft main deck, 400V/3ph/50Hz, make Italwinch (or Quick / Muir, alternate)
  • Foredeck crane: (1) fixed crane, 1,500kg SWL, remote and wired control, sized for a Williams 565 / Castoldi 568 tender; man-riding certified
  • Passerelle: Besenzoni PI483 (or Opacmare, alternate)
  • Z-lift swim platform: aluminum, hydraulically operated, 650kg SWL, teak-stepped, minimum 1m below the waterline
  • Side boarding ladder: (1) aluminum, removable, with rails, fitted to port and starboard
  • Jacuzzi: aft main deck, make INACE, fresh-water fill from the pool tank
  • Searchlights: ACR (or equal, alternate)
  • Horn: Kahlenberg S-330
  • Underwater lights: Lumishore (or OceanLED, alternate)


Exterior Deck Arrangement

  • Sun Deck Aft
    • The sun deck aft is laid out as a lounging area, with the integrated seating and sunbathing sections built over locker storage accessed through lightweight hatches in the deck. Removable canvas sun awnings on carbon-fiber poles, fitted into flush-mounted bulwark sockets with a battery light atop each pole, shade the space; the poles stow via removable covers when not in use.
  • Bridge Deck Aft
    • A dedicated seating arrangement occupies the upper deck aft, centered on a fixed midship dining table and chairs for al fresco meals. A sliding weathertight door with safety glass, matched in color to the exterior windows, connects the space to the interior, with infra-red sensors so the door re-opens automatically for anyone passing through.
  • Aft Main Deck
    • The aft main deck centers on a jacuzzi filled with fresh water drawn from the pool tank and discharged to a dedicated pool dump tank, fitted with a manually operated removable hard cover matching the teak decking. A removable stainless-steel external shower (pole shower with telephone handset, plus a separate hand shower) is set into a deck socket on the swim platform, with hot and cold water feed. A second sliding weathertight entrance door, matching the upper deck door in style, connects the deck to the interior.

Deck Finishes

  • All exterior decks are teak-clad in traditional 50mm-wide planking, 10mm thick after sanding, laid over faired decks on a lightweight bedding compound with grey calking — with the exception of the storage deck beneath the pool deck. Handrails and handholds in polished stainless steel (AISI 316L) run along stairways and bulwark tops throughout.

Accommodations

ISY 115 EXPLORA is designed to accommodate up to 5 cabins for Owners and guests and 4 cabins for Crew, arranged across the upper and lower decks as follows;

  • Bridge / Upper Deck
    • Owner's Cabin: full beam, 1 king bed, en-suite bath with steam shower
    • Captain's Cabin: 1 single bed + 1 bunk bed
  • Lower Deck
    • (2) VIP Cabins: 1 double bed each, en-suite
    • (2) Guest Cabins: 2 single beds + 1 bunk bed each, en-suite
  • Crew Quarters
    • (3) Crew Cabins: 2 single beds each, en-suite
    • Crew Mess
